A Frightening Experience_Revised



It was the most horrible experience that I had had in my ninth grade.
We students had to study at school at night and take turns throwing the leftover. That night was my turn to do this task, and whoever was responsible for this job had to go down the dark, vastly long corridor and trees alone. Just after my several steps to go back, I heard a slight sound which was like something falling on the ground. Suddenly, I noticed that there was an object in front of me, just four meters away. Since all lights had turned off, I couldn’t recognize what it was. Additionally, I was too afraid to get close to the unknown stuff. What with the appearance of the moon, what with my eyes’ adaptation to the darkness; gradually, the identity of the figure finally came out.
It was a pigeon whose chest was rotten with a large amount of blood pouring out from it. As the pigeon fell from the air to the ground, I stiffly moved my sight up and was surprised to find the suspect easily, partly  because it smack stood on the branch which was above its prey, and partly because there was only one animal, a squirrel, which had a bloody mouse looking down from trees.
I was stunned into silence as I saw the squirrel’s eyes staring sharply at the moribund, shivering pigeon, and some sort of fright took the place of my favor to gentle squirrels.
